TORONTO, Ontario (WLFI) - George Hill connected on a shot with two seconds remaining to lift the Indiana Pacers to a 90-88 victory over the Toronto Raptors in the Pacers regular season opener Wednesday night at Air Canada Centre in Toronto.
David West led the Pacers with 25 points, 14 of his points coming in the fourth quarter. Paul George added 14 points and 15 rebounds while All-Star center Roy Hibbert chipped in with 14 points, nine rebounds, and five blocked shots.
The Pacers return to action Friday evening when they visit the Charlotte Bobcats. The Pacers home opener is Saturday evening against the Sacramento Kings at Bankers Life Fieldhouse in Indianapolis.
